ABS plastic frames are impact-resistant, durable, lightweight, and cost-effective
ABS plastic is a widely used material for eyeglass frames. It is known for its impact resistance, durability, lightweight nature, and cost-effectiveness. These qualities make it a popular choice for those seeking a pair of glasses that can withstand daily wear and tear while remaining comfortable and affordable.
ABS plastic frames are impact-resistant, meaning they can endure knocks and bumps without breaking easily. This makes them a good option for those who lead active lifestyles or tend to be hard on their eyewear. The impact resistance of ABS plastic also contributes to its durability, ensuring that the frames can last for an extended period without showing significant signs of wear and tear.
ABS plastic is also known for its lightweight properties, making it a comfortable choice for eyeglass wearers. Heavier frame materials can cause discomfort after extended periods of wear, especially for those with sensitive noses or ears. ABS plastic frames, on the other hand, are lightweight and gentle on the face, making them ideal for everyday use.
In addition to their durability and lightweight nature, ABS plastic frames offer cost-effectiveness. They are typically more affordable than frames made from other materials, such as metal or wood. This makes them a popular choice for those who may need multiple pairs of glasses, such as those who require separate pairs for reading and distance vision, or those who want a backup pair for travel or outdoor activities.
The design of ABS plastic frames is also worth noting. The modular design of ABS plastic frames allows for easy customization and modification. Designers can add aesthetic touches, such as embossed patterns or metallic finishes, to enhance the appearance of the frames. This combination of functionality and aesthetics makes ABS plastic frames a versatile option for consumers.

They are easy to mould for complex designs, making them versatile
ABS plastic frames are known for their durability, versatility, and lightweight nature. They are widely used for making eyewear, especially sports frames. ABS plastic is strong and flexible, and its frames are impact-resistant, durable, and cost-effective.
ABS plastic frames are easy to mould for complex designs, making them versatile. The injection moulding process involves melting plastic pallets and injecting them into a mould for shaping. The accuracy of the injection mould decides the final structure of the frames. The mould is the biggest investment in the production of injection eyewear. To produce an injection frame, two sets of moulds are needed: one for the front and one for the two temples. The cost of one front mould ranges from $1,300 to $2,000, depending on the complexity of the structure.
The modular design of ABS plastic frames makes them easy to create, modify, and upgrade. They can be designed in different sizes and shapes by changing some parts. Damaged frames can also be easily repaired by replacing the damaged module. The aesthetics of ABS plastic frames are another important aspect, and designers can add embossed patterns or in-mould decorations to enhance their appearance.

ABS plastic is strong and flexible, but may not be suitable for sun or water exposure
ABS plastic is a common thermoplastic polymer that is strong, flexible, and lightweight. It is made by polymerizing styrene and acrylonitrile in the presence of polybutadiene. The resulting material is stronger than pure polystyrene, with increased hardness, rigidity, and heat deflection temperature. The polybutadiene in ABS plastic provides toughness and ductility at low temperatures, although this comes at the cost of reduced heat resistance and rigidity.
ABS plastic is often used in the production of eyeglass frames due to its impact resistance, durability, and cost-effectiveness. Its lightweight and flexible properties make it ideal for complex designs, and its good chemical resistance makes it suitable for various applications and environments.
However, one consideration when using ABS plastic for eyeglass frames is its sensitivity to sun and water exposure. ABS plastic can be damaged by sunlight, so it is important to keep it out of direct sun. Prolonged exposure to UV light can cause photo-oxidation of polymers, breaking the polymer chains and leading to discolouration and brittleness. Therefore, if ABS plastic frames are intended for outdoor use or exposure to sunlight, it is recommended to look for frames with additional UV protection or consider alternative materials, such as polycarbonate.
Additionally, while ABS plastic has good impact resistance, it is important to note that it may not be the best choice for water-resistant applications. Although ABS plastic has a low melting point and can be welded by heating joint surfaces, its sensitivity to heat and open flames should be considered. Overall, while ABS plastic offers many desirable characteristics for eyeglass frames, its limitations in terms of sun and water exposure may make it unsuitable for certain specific applications or environments.

ABS plastic frames are produced by melting down plastic pallets and injecting them into a mould for shaping. The moulding process is critical as it determines the final structure of the frames. The accuracy of the injection mould and the machine setup, including parameters such as working temperature, injection force, and shaping time, are essential for the production of high-quality ABS plastic frames.
